Disney Vacation Club Resorts
There are six Disney World resorts included in Disney Vacation Club. Any guest can reserve a nightly room, just as a regular hotel room. [p] Room choices range from studios (mini-suites with pull-out sofas and a tiny kitchens) to three-bedroom units with full kitchens. Some include washer/dryer units. Another plus - gift shops will typically carry basic grocery items like milk, cereal and snacks.
